DO078

Panoramica tecnica di Quarkus

Panoramica

Migliora lo sviluppo Java con Quarkus, il futuro dello sviluppo software aziendale.

Descrizione del corso

  • Scopri la potenza di Quarkus in questa serie di video di panoramica tecnica gratuiti pensati per gli sviluppatori Java moderni. Questa formazione on demand mostra come Quarkus offra tempi di avvio rapidissimi e un utilizzo minimo della memoria per le applicazioni cloud native. Scopri le esclusive ottimizzazioni in fase di creazione e approfitta di un'esperienza di sviluppo senza precedenti con codifica in tempo reale, servizi con provisioning automatico e test continui. Scopri come sviluppare e distribuire le applicazioni in modo semplice come immagini dei container efficienti in OpenShift o come file binari nativi. Migliora lo sviluppo Java con Quarkus, il futuro dello sviluppo software aziendale.

Riepilogo dei contenuti del corso

  • Questa panoramica tecnica offre un percorso pratico che guida l'utente nella generazione di un'applicazione Quarkus e nell'integrazione di estensioni essenziali come REST, JDBC, Hibernate con Panache, controlli di integrità, OpenAPI e generatori di immagini dei container come Podman. Scopri la magia dell'esperienza di sviluppo di Quarkus, con una codifica in tempo reale che rispecchia istantaneamente le modifiche al codice, inclusi il refactoring complesso e gli aggiornamenti dello schema del database, senza dover riavviare il server. Scopri di più su DevServices, che consente di eseguire il provisioning di servizi esterni come i database per lo sviluppo locale e sfrutta l'intuitiva interfaccia utente di sviluppo per il monitoraggio e la configurazione uniformi. Scopri i test continui, che vengono eseguiti automaticamente a ogni modifica del codice, consentendo un flusso di lavoro di sviluppo realmente agile e basato su test. Infine, il corso illustra come creare e distribuire le applicazioni Quarkus sotto forma di immagini dei container altamente efficienti in locale con Podman e come farlo in modo uniforme sulla piattaforma per container OpenShift, completa di configurazioni adeguate delle variabili del percorso, dei segreti e dell'ambiente per l'accesso esterno e le connessioni sicure al database.

Destinatari del corso

  • Questo corso è destinato agli sviluppatori di applicazioni Java.

Formazione consigliata

  • Non sono previsti requisiti per questa panoramica tecnica.
Struttura del corso

Programma del corso

  • Perché Quarkus?
  • L'ingrediente segreto di Quarkus
  • Come creare un'applicazione
  • La gioia degli sviluppatori di Quarkus
  • Test continui
  • Creazione ed esecuzione di immagini di container con Podman
  • Creazione ed esecuzione di un eseguibile nativo
  • Deployment delle applicazioni su OpenShift
  • Passaggi successivi per la formazione su Quarkus
Risultati

Scegli il Paese

Corsi disponibili in sede

I tuoi team possono accedere ai corsi di formazione presso la tua azienda, in presenza o in modalità remota.

Red Hat Learning Subscription

Percorsi di formazione e training completi sui prodotti Red Hat, certificazioni riconosciute nel settore e un'esperienza di formazione IT flessibile e dinamica.

Scopri l'esperienza di altri studenti che hanno partecipato a questo corso, nella Red Hat Learning Community.